This Is Alice
The Elephant (Season 1, Episode 36)
TV Episode | 30 min |Comedy
The Holliday parents are perplexed when daughter Alice brings home an elephant as a pet. What to do with the wild animal becomes the focus of the family.
Director
Writers
Sidney Salkow (created by) |William Cowley (written by) |Peggy Chantler Dick (written by) (as Peggy Chantler)
Producer
Sidney Salkow (produced by)
Cinematographer
Charles Burke (as Chas. E. Burke)
Editor
Irving M. Schoenberg (as Irving Schoenberg)
Casting Director
Kerwin Coughlin (casting by)
